Your two scenarios don't really bear comparison to me. In scenario one, provided you are already in receipt of a BS, the controller/FISO already knows your details. This will include a/c type and last reported position and level. Even if you haven't made a specific position report for a few minutes, the controller is quite capable of working out where you are to within a few miles. Additionally, we'll also (assuming we've had a call from them) know of other a/c in the area who can go and have a look for you, and who has the time to provide us with a more specific location. I have yet to speak to a pilot who won't help out a fellow aviator in this situation.

In scenario two, you may have to provide all your details to D&D in that one Mayday call. Especially as, at 1500ft, it is unlikely you will manage a full triangulation from D&D.
